Handbook to Classical Reception in Eastern and Central Europe
Discover the rich tapestry of classical antiquity in Eastern and Central Europe with A Handbook to Classical Reception in Eastern and Central Europe by Zara Martirosova Torlone. Published by John Wiley and Sons Ltd in 2017, this groundbreaking work is the first comprehensive English-language study exploring how classical literature has influenced the region's cultural and intellectual landscape. Spanning an impressive 632 pages, this hardback edition delves into the nuances of history and criticism, offering readers a detailed examination of the reception of classical texts and ideas.
